Abstract
N1,N2-Bis[1-(2-hydroxyphenyl)methylidene]ethanedihydrazide (MEH) was used as new compound which plays the role of an excellent ion carrier in the fabrication of a Ho(III) membrane electrode. The electrode shows a good selectivity for Ho(III) ion with respect to most common cations including alkali, alkaline earth, transition and heavy metal ions. This electrode has a wide linear dynamic range from 1.0 × 10−6 to 1.0 × 10−2 mol/L with a Nernstian slope of 19.8 ± 0.3 mV per decade and a low detection limit of 5.8 × 10−7 mol/L in the pH range of 2.5–9.8, while the response time was rapid (<10 s). The suggested sensor was applied to the determination of Ho(III) ions in tap water and river water samples.
